view more20191212 · Compared with traditional mechanically ground particle materials, superfine food powder has outstanding characteristics including high solubility, dispersion, adsorption, chemical reactivity, and fluidity. [ 6 – 9] This is because superfine grinding can increase the particle surface area and break down cell walls.
